EUREKA, CA  –  Authorities in Humboldt County are investigating an armed robbery in Eureka.

According to a press release by the Sheriff’s Office, deputies responded to an armed robbery at Fairway Market on Herrick Avenue in Eureka at around 9 p.m. Monday, Sept. 30.

According to the store owner, a man entered the market, pointed a firearm at him, and demanded cash, allegedly threatening to shoot if the demand was not met.

The suspect fled on foot and was last seen in the area of Carolyn Court.

Deputies arrived within minutes of the initial call but were unable to locate the suspect.

The suspect is described as a white male, about 6 feet tall, weighing 150-160 pounds, wearing a black hooded sweatshirt, black pants, black gloves, and carrying a blue canvas bag.

Authorities are continuing to investigate and encourage anyone with information to contact the Humboldt County Sheriff’s Office.
